David Doubell

David Doubell

David is an Executive Creative Director by day and a Toonist by night. He has been in the design and advertising world, from the time of the Macintosh IIsi. Since then lots of things have changed, the colour of his hair and the Mac he uses, but some things have stayed the same, like the love of design, and cartoons. When not designing, you’ll find him doodling and on rare occasions having a cold beer or two.

The Daily Friend is the online newspaper of the Institute of Race Relations. The IRR was established in 1929 to promote political and economic freedom, and rose to become the most prominent anti-apartheid think tank in the world.
